MOJO�S WORKIN�

Mojo Nixon and his partner Skid Roper are strangely out of their element, virtually trapped in a little square room deep below the Hollywood soundstage of The Late Show. Wearing their road-worn denim and sitting with a couple of buddies, they wait anxiously for their big moment which will come later that night.

Cold pizza, a fancy fruit basket and six*packs of Jolt Cola are within easy reach. And watching over it all are Gumby, waving down from the TV, and Elvis, his brooding face painted on a rug hanging from the wall.

"You know, it doesn�t smell like piss in here,� says Mojo in his quick Southern drawl, comparing the room to most places he�s played. "Usually these rooms smell like piss and there�s this deranged writing on the wall.�
